2020 Lincoln MKZ EPA Fuel Economy Summary

The 2020 Lincoln MKZ delivers an EPA-certified 20–41 MPG combined (17–42 city / 26–39 highway depending on engine and drivetrain) across 5 configurations. Hybrid variants achieve up to 41 MPG combined, compared to 24 MPG for standard gasoline trims. Estimated annual fuel costs range from $1,500 to $3,100.

Official EPA Fuel Economy Ratings by Configuration (5 Variants)

Laboratory certification test values across engine, transmission, and drivetrain permutations

Configuration / Model Powertrain Drivetrain Transmission City Highway Combined Annual Fuel Cost CO2 (g/mi)
MKZ FWD Regular 2L 4-Cyl Gas Front-Wheel Drive Automatic (S6) 20 MPG 31 MPG 24 MPG $2,550
MKZ FWD Regular 3L 6-Cyl Gas Front-Wheel Drive Automatic (S6) 18 MPG 27 MPG 21 MPG $2,950
MKZ AWD Regular 2L 4-Cyl Gas All-Wheel Drive Automatic (S6) 20 MPG 29 MPG 23 MPG $2,650
MKZ AWD Regular 3L 6-Cyl Gas All-Wheel Drive Automatic (S6) 17 MPG 26 MPG 20 MPG $3,100
MKZ Hybrid FWD Regular 2L Hybrid Front-Wheel Drive Automatic (variable gear ratios) 42 MPG 39 MPG 41 MPG $1,500
EPA Test Methodology: Fuel economy estimates are determined by vehicle manufacturers in accordance with EPA regulations (40 CFR Part 600) and verified by EPA laboratories. Estimates assume 15,000 miles per year of driving (55% city, 45% highway) at prevailing fuel and electricity prices.
